Ocho Rios resort town is warm and humid throughout the year, shaping what you choose to wear. Prepare for sunshine, potential rain, and the chance to wear clothes up for celebrations. Prioritize lightweight, breathable fabrics like cotton, linen, and moisture-sweat-wicking synthetic fabrics. These materials give space for air circulation and dry fast, which is helpful in humid conditions. Pack plenty of shorts, t-shirts, tank tops, and lightweight dresses or skirts.
Dress codes in Ocho Rios are generally relaxed, particularly in areas with tourists and resorts. Beachwear is perfectly acceptable on beaches and by pools. However, thought for local customs is always welcome.
Comfortable walking sandals or accessible-toed shoes are great for everyday wear in the warm climate. Choose options with good arch support if you're planning extensive walking.
Water shoes are highly recommended for rocky beaches, river tubing, or waterfall climbs (like Dunn's River Falls or the Blue Hole). They shield your feet from sharp rocks and present good grip on slippery surfaces.
For longer walks, hikes, or exploring uneven terrain, pack comfortable closed-toe Walking shoes or Light hiking shoes with good grip. These give stability and protection.

Your gadgets connect you, help with navigation, and document memories. Plan for power needs and local compatibility. Jamaica uses 110/120V and 50Hz, with Type A and Type B plugs (same as North America).
